i know a registered assessor can assess but if its done ad hoc way who verifys it?
 
Hi Fuzzy,

You are asking all the right questions. The College where the NVQ is undertaken will verify. If they are not happy with it they will not approve the Field Assessments. If you are transferring to a private training group, it is the same. Their own internal verifier puts the final stamp on it all before sending it off for re-verification by the certification body then actual certification.

do you have any idea how long this process takes when doing it this way, is it the same when at college for interest?...
 
Again it is simple. The time it takes, is the time it takes to develop and pressent the skills learned in college in the field, and of course for the assessor to find a space in his/her diary. It make take several visits. The larger question is where is the field experience being gained ?? and is their supporting evidence, is the documentation supplied by the course provider (i.e City & Guilds) complete for both on and off job elements so that the assessor can approve it. Many colleges have massive waiting lists for their own assessors to come out, and even some of the leading ones are so busy they have had to send out unapproved or un accredited guys so i assume this is why you are looking for independant ???
